How much do temporary cpg j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 8, 2026, the average hourly pay for temporary cpg in the United States is $18.38,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.38 and $19.95 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

The Project Manager leads cross-functional teams to deliver complex initiatives across the Kodiak portfolio - on time, on quality, and on budget. This role owns projects end-to-end from concept through commercialization, ensuring alignment to the Stage Gate process and providing clear communication of status, actions, risks, and mitigation strategies to stakeholders, including executive leadership. 


 

What will the position do: 

  • Provide ownership and strategic oversight of the Frozen and Oatmeal category project portfolios, ensuring prioritization, execution, and delivery of all product launch and change initiatives. 
  • Lead cross-functional teams through Kodiak’s Stage Gate process, ensuring alignment to project briefs, gate document requirements, and business objectives. 
  • Build and maintain project plans and associated reports in Monday.com. 
  • Plan for and facilitate cross-functional project and category meetings, drive decision making, and ensure clear accountability for action items. 
  • Communicate project status, risks, and mitigation strategies to cross-functional teams and executive leadership, both verbally and in writing. 
  • Manage commercialization processes by following Kodiak product launch and change templates. 
  • Partner with external stakeholders, including contract manufacturers, suppliers, and printers to deliver project objectives.
